“Your Career Is Dead, Dem No Know Your Gbedu Again” – Davido Fires Back At Wizkid

Nigerian music star, Davido has fired back at his colleague, Wizkid, igniting a heated exchange on social media.

The onging feud started on Monday when Wizkid shared a viral video of Davido, where the latter was seen crying on his knees, purportedly begging with an American model.

In his response, Davido took to the X platform later that evening, delivering what seemed like a veiled critique of Wizkid’s music, suggesting a decline in its recognition.

“Dem no know ur gbedu [music] again,” Davido tweeted.

Following Davido’s tweets, Wizkid responded saying, “U know what..no point. delusional niggas pray for y’all.”

Davido promptly quoted Wizkid’s post, describing him as a “sick man,” addressing Wizkid’s earlier comment about their alleged delusion.

Wizkid then shared the viral video of Davido begging, prompting Davido to respond, expressing regret for investing in resurrecting Wizkid’s career, only to see it fade once more.

He wrote, “That’s what I thought. Nothing to say! Exactly why I stopped wasting my clout and jeopardizing my millions of usd of endorsements on someone whose career was resurrected a few years ago just to die again. NEXT!!”.

The clash between Wizkid and Davido has stirred heated debates on social media, with fans of both artists engaging in online spats.
